This guide explains how to use the SHL Data Pro license effectively.
It covers all main components: match statistics, DataStudio, and how to create analyses as a Coach or analyst.

1. What do you get with the SHL Data Pro license?

With the Pro license, you have access to all available SHL statistics, including:

  • Attacks and defensive actions
  • Shots
  • Technical faults
  • And much more

For each shot, multiple attributes are stored, such as:

  • Result (goal, miss, save)
  • Location on the goal
  • Location near the circle
  • Name of the shooter
  • Player providing the assist (for goals)
  • Goalkeeper who was in goal

This information can be used for analysis on match, team, positional, and individual level.

2. Match Dashboard

From the match overview, you can click the graph icon next to a match to open that match’s dashboard.

What do you see in the dashboard?

  • Team totals, such as number of attacks, goals and technical faults
  • Player statistics, such as number of shots and efficiency
  • Detailed shot locations: where the shot was taken from and where it ended up on the goal

Viewing clips

By clicking on numbers or shot indicators, you can directly open the corresponding video clips.

Important warning

Do NOT click the tag icon next to a match!

If you click it, you will see the message “COPY”.
This creates a copy of the match data. Only do this if you intentionally want to create duplicates.

3. DataStudio

You can access DataStudio via the logo in the top-left corner.

What can you do in DataStudio?

  • Request data for all teams and all matches
  • View different overviews where statistics are shown per team
  • Goalkeepers can analyze their own numbers over multiple matches
  • Additional information such as Type of attack is available, for example: Power play, Fast break, Second wave, and so on.

DataStudio is iDeal for:

  • In-depth statistical analyses
  • Comparing multiple matches
  • Comparing Team statistics/efficiency
  • Monitoring goalkeeper and player performance

4. Creating analyses as coach, trainer or analyst

The Pro License offers extensive possibilities to create your own analyses.

What can you do?

  • Defenders can study how opponents shoot to adjust their defensive positioning.
  • Goalkeepers can see where players tend to place their shots.
  • Players can watch clips of themselves or others to improve their decision-making and technique.

Using the Playlist feature

As a coach, the playlist function is especially useful for preparation and Team meetings.

For every clip you watch, you can click “Add to playlist” at the bottom of the video.
This allows you to build a Playlist with all the moments you want to show during your Team talk.

You can, for example:

  • Watch and select attacks and add them to a Playlist such as “Next opponent”
  • Line up all shots of a key player to discuss how to stop them
  • Collect defensive actions from the opponent and show them to your team

Advantage of a playlist:
You can combine clips from multiple matches into one clear, continuous list. Perfect for match briefings and tactical preparation.
